"The way that the conversation has evolved over the past few months has really aggravated and made more stark partisan divides in the country," said Artur Wilczynski, a senior fellow at the University of Ottawa. National security expert and former public servant Artur Wilczynski said an inquiry would help to focus Canada on how it should position itself to combat foreign interference.
